PedroAntonioSpain flag
I think that the rule is there for some reason.
I mean, if I don't want to put a time limit I put a 14 days/move (if you don't come back in 14 days, maybe you can't even remember the matchs you was playing). If you are playing a non-tournament match with no points you can break some rules, after all, its a friendly, but if you are playing for points (on a tournament or not) you have to do what rules say, and after p.e. 7 days without moving (or 3 or 14), you lost. I think that even if your rival does not claim the game, you should not move, because you lost. Some kind of auto-claiming pointed games.

Nobody would think of moving the Rook on a diagonal, nobody should think of move after time has passed.
